chris at ob hmls sunday june 16 2013Nowadays it’s pretty easy to find out about folks who play music here in Colorado.  We’ve got lots of great music discovery programs and video sessions. Loft Sessions, Second Story Garage, and Open Air 1340 are the creme-du-jour, and then there are the interview programs that feature live music like KRFC’s Live At Lunch.   Want to know about the music, the band etc?  Easy.  Want to find out about the person him/herself?  Not so easy.

So, here’s the deal.  Beginning in mid July I will be debuting a new podcast.  Coming up with a new idea wasn’t easy.  I’ve been asked for several years to consider doing a music or interview based podcast.  Music podcasts are out as a matter of federal copyright law, and all of the interview programs I’ve heard have been heavy on music talk – not personal talk.

Inspired by (and instigated by) the “gentle persuasions” of two very good friends of mine in Northern Colorado radio, and currently being developed under the working title “Colorado Living Room Sessions,” host Chris K, aka goat, will visit music dignitaries, luminaries, legends, award winners, industry leaders, and emerging regional and national Colorado acts – in their (living rooms) – providing a much more intimate “look” into the lives of those who bring us our music.

The story is not about the music, but the person behind the music. It’s me  and  ______________ sitting comfortably, chatting about life, family, sports, profession, influences, inspirations, challenges, kids, grand kids, jobs, whatever and wherever the conversation may go.

This is not to say that music won’t be a part of the podcast (LOL … like that would ever happen), but it will be used as a bridge or break or to amplify some facet of what’s taking place in the conversation. And of course, if there’s a new record or major event or something music related, it will be included.

Currently we’re planning a 15-20 minute podcast.  There is also ongoing discussion whether I’ll do a weekly or bi-weekly episode.  The thought right now is that each episode could will be produced in two 15-20 minute parts (EP1/part1, EP1/part2)…  with a new episode every other week … lots to consider.  Shorter segments of 2-3 minutes will be edited for inclusion in weekly radio shows, as a tease for the full podcast.

News Notes and Spins May 1, 2014

The first “offical” (unofficially speaking) festival weekend of the month has come and gone … with what appeared to me to be record crowds at FoCoMX (Fort Collins Music Experiment) #6.  That at least from my vantage point at Equinox Brewing on Fri and Sat.  On Sunday, my wife and I purchased a vendor space at the Root 40 Music Festival.   Some very good friends also happened to be there.

ParkHouse_logo_squareAward winning producer/engineer John Macy (pedal steel – Casey James Prestwood & the Burning Angels) and I spent a LOT of time taking about the new “house” he’s in – called Park House, it occupies the space on E. Colfax and Madison (actual address is 1515 Madison) once adorned by the Normandy Restaurant.

John has opened up the NEW Macy Sound Studios in part of the building, and suggested that live recordings and live-streaming shows are in the works.  There are a few videos at the venue website … well worth checking out this “new” venue (guess it’s been open over a year now?) …  and some crazy good artists/bands playing the room.  John also told me he’s remixing the second release from The Congress – and that the new Richie Furay record will be self released sometime this summer.

In a sign to take our mortality, and our health, seriously, both Dan Treanor and Johnny O wound up in the hospital this past month.  Dan and Johnny both seem to be none-the-worse for the heart problems that put a smack-down on our friends, and the out pouring of support from musicians all over the region was genuine and heartfelt by everyone.

Also in news this week … it dawned on me that this is the 30th Anniversary of some auspicious happenings in our scene … 30 years ago Candy Givens from the band Zephyr died after drowning in her hot tub, from a deadly combination of alcohol and Quaalude.

zephyr bathtubZephyr c0-founder David Givens is releasing a number of recordings from the Zephyr catalog, including the 1982 “Heartbeat” record, and a box set that contains the “Rainbow In the Bathtub” record from ’69, a live show from Tulagi’s in Boulder, and a cd of outtakes and demos.  Amazon shows it will be available on May 27, and a limited numbered run is currently available for pre-order.  David also let me know he’s got other Zephyr and Legendary 4Nikators records he’d like to release this year as well.

Other 30th Anniversaries include Chris Daniels & the Kings, who will be releasing a new disc in time for summer that will feature legendary Denver (by way of Phoenix) soul master Freddi Gowdy.  Chris is also finishing up recording the new Magic Music release – from the band that started it all for Chris in the early 70s.  And finally – Airshow Mastering celebrates their 30th anniversary also.  Lots of love to all our friends celebrating this year.
